What is a Built-In Cooker?

A built-in cooker is a home appliance that is created to be installed straight into kitchen cabinetry or walls for a structured appearance. They come in various types including ovens, ranges, and microwave ovens. Built-in cookers can be integrated into kitchens in several methods, whether through a modular setup or a customized configuration that deals with particular personal choices and cooking needs.

Types of Built-In Cookers

When thinking about built-in cookers, it’s crucial to comprehend the numerous types readily available. Here’s a take a look at some of the most typical:

  1. Built-In Ovens: These can be installed at eye level or under the counter top. They can be found in various styles including single, double, convection, and steam ovens.

  2. Induction Cooktops: These use electromagnetic energy to heat pots and pans straight, supplying a more efficient cooking technique compared to traditional gas or electric stoves.

  3. Built-In Microwave Ovens: These compact appliances can be set up into kitchen cabinetry, saving counter area while mixing with the kitchen style.

  4. Wall Ovens: Offering a more professional appearance, wall ovens can take different types and supply sophisticated cooking functions for the enthusiastic chef.

Key Features of Built-In Cookers

Built-in cookers included a range of features that raise them from basic appliances to essential kitchen parts. Here are some key functions to consider:

  • Aesthetic Appeal: With a series of surfaces and styles, built-in cookers can boost the visual appeal of any kitchen.

  • Area Efficiency: Built-in systems are developed to save space, making them ideal for smaller sized kitchens that require a thoughtful method to layout.

  • Smart Technology Integration: Many modern built-in cookers come geared up with smart innovation that allows users to control functions via smart devices or voice activation.

  • Advanced Cooking Features: Built-in cookers typically consist of functions like self-cleaning, steam cooking, and accuracy temperature control for customized cooking experiences.

Advantages of Built-In Cookers

Picking to install built-in cookers can offer various advantages that contribute to both visual appeals and performance in the kitchen. Some notable benefits consist of:

  • Seamless Design: Built-in cookers create a refined look that matches kitchen cabinetry and reduces visual clutter.

  • Improved Ergonomics: Many built-in units are created at comfortable heights, reducing the need to bend down as with conventional cookers.

  • Increased Home Value: Aesthetic enhancements through built-in cookers can increase the overall value of the home, attracting potential buyers.

  • Personalized Cooking Experience: With numerous designs and features readily available, property owners can choose specific cookers that best meet their culinary needs.

Considerations When Choosing Built-In Cookers

While the advantages are substantial, several factors need to be considered when selecting built-in cookers, including:

  • Kitchen Layout: Evaluate the existing kitchen layout to understand what type and size of built-in cooker will fit best.

  • Budget plan: Built-in cookers can differ substantially in rate. It’s important to develop a clear spending plan that consists of installation costs.

  • Energy Efficiency: Look for energy-efficient models that can assist lower energy costs in the long run.

  • Brand name Reputation: Research various brands and their reliability, warranty offerings, and customer support for informed decision-making.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. Are built-in cookers a good financial investment?

Yes, built-in cookers often boost the general visual of the kitchen and can increase the resale worth of your home. They likewise usually provide advanced functions for a more efficient cooking experience.

2. Just how much do built-in cookers cost?

Prices for built-in cookers can range widely based on features, brand name, and setup intricacy. On average, expect to spend between ₤ 800 and ₤ 3,000, with additional expenses for installation.

3. Can I install a built-in cooker myself?

While setup of built in cooker (click through the up coming webpage)-in cookers can be carried out by skilled DIY enthusiasts, it’s recommended to employ specialists to guarantee proper fit and security, specifically for gas cookers.

4. Which type of built-in cooker is best for small kitchen areas?

Induction cooktops and built-in microwave are outstanding options for little cooking areas due to their compact design and effective usage of space.

5. Are built-in cookers energy efficient?

Lots of built-in cookers feature energy-efficient innovations that help in reducing energy consumption. Look for models with the ENERGY STAR ® label for the very best effectiveness.
